Geekbench 5 Benchmarks
Intel Core i7-4765T | vs | Intel Core i9-11900 |
---|---|---|
Jun 2nd, 2013 | Release Date | Mar 16th, 2021 |
Core i7 | Collection | Core i9 |
Haswell | Codename | Rocket Lake |
Intel Socket 1150 | Socket | Intel Socket 1200 |
Desktop | Segment | Desktop |
4 | Cores | 8 |
8 | Threads | 16 |
2.0 GHz | Base Clock Speed | 2.5 GHz |
3.0 GHz | Turbo Clock Speed | 5.2 GHz |
35 W | TDP | 65 W |
22 nm | Process Size | 14 nm |
20.0x | Multiplier | 25.0x |
Intel HD 4600 | Integrated Graphics | UHD Graphics 750 |
No | Overclockable | No |
